Sanitation starts within individual buildings.The textbook covers the principles of plumbing, including soil pipes, waste pipes, and vent pipes.It highlights the importance of "traps" (like the P-trap or S-trap) which hold a water seal.This simple mechanism prevents foul sewer gases from entering living spaces. Before laying a single pipe, engineers must calculate how much water a population requires.Rangwala details methods for forecasting population growth over a "design period," usually 20 to 30 years.The book explains various water demands, including domestic, industrial, commercial, and public uses.It also covers the "fire demand," which is the critical volume needed to fight fires.Students learn to account for fluctuations in daily and hourly consumption rates. 2.
